Output effcba97e8d3842c2e688b13ced4d1dc8b438deca222d3d55af552c045f831a0:4

value
133264000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5ae5c6cf73d54f73b4bd2c3b238b0813c0da161 OP_EQUALVERIFY OP_CHECKSIG
address
DTY8y5FncuoRYc8MLa1D37g3oAoPpze7JM
transaction
effcba97e8d3842c2e688b13ced4d1dc8b438deca222d3d55af552c045f831a0